The greatest common factor (GCF) of 16 and 12 is 4. This is the largest number that evenly divides 12 and 16. It can be found by looking at the factors of those numbers:
12 = 4·3
16 = 4·4
Or it can be found by seeing if the difference of the numbers (4) evenly divides them both. It does, so that is the GCF.
The greatest number of sets Mandy can make is 4.
__
Each of Mandy's 4 sets will have 4 sheets of paper and 3 envelopes.

Recursive formulas give us two pieces of information:
The first term of the sequence
The pattern rule to get any term from the term that comes before it
